Subject: Catalog cache invalidation fix shipping tonight

Team — tonight's release changes how Lattermill's product catalog invalidates cached entries. Previously we purged by category, which left stale price entries when an item moved categories mid-update. We now purge by item key and fan out to category indexes afterward. Future maintainers: the ordering matters; do not reverse it, or you reintroduce the stale-price window. The release is cut from the build noted below.

session token of tajef-bageg = htk21_5d90d574934f3ccae6437

Ticket: Staging env misconfigured for Siftgate bloom filter

The bloom layer in front of the Pellet KV store is rejecting all lookups in staging because the env file was copied from the dev template without credentials. False-positive tuning values are fine; only the auth line is missing. To unblock the weekly demo, the Pellet admission secret must be set on the following line.

env line for yaguf-fajop: LEDGER_TOKEN13=fb08984397349

Briefing — Leadership Review, Tollbright Eateries

The franchise agreement with Hadlow Provisions covers twelve branches across the Merrivale region. Royalty terms are standard at 6% of gross, with a marketing levy of 2%. Renewal falls due within eighteen months; performance clauses require minimum quarterly volumes. Branch managers should ensure reporting compliance ahead of the review. Our negotiating position is outlined below.

confidential, yagep-kagef: Rusvanox Holdings is in early talks to buy Julwynix Systems for about $454.5 million. The Fenael launch date is April 23, and nothing goes to the press before then. Legal wants the Druwynix Works term sheet redrafted before January 8.

ValidatorHub plugins are loaded at boot from the plugins manifest. If the Marrowline validator suite fails its handshake, first confirm the registry endpoint in .env matches the active region, then restart the loader with the drain flag to avoid dropping in-flight checks. Before restarting, ensure the plugin registry token appears on the line directly below this one in .env.

sealed setting: RELAY_SECRET5=82864